Thomas Towns of Long Clawson 1637 Will and Inventory
Leicestershire, Leicester and Rutland Archives PR/T/1637/78
In the name of gode Amen This fourth daye of Auguste in the 13 yeare of the raygne of or Soveraigne Lord Charles by the grace of god, of England, Scotland, France & Irelande Kinge defender of the faith &c 1637 I Thomas Touns of the towne of Claxton als long Clauston, in the Countie of Leceister, Laborer, beinge sicke of bodie but of good & perfect memorye praysed bee god doe make & ordayne this my last will & testament in manner & forme followeing
In primis I give & bequeave my soule to god that gave it, & my bodie to be buried in the Church yard of the parishe church of Claxton aforesaide
Itim I give unto my eldest sonn Richarde Touns xxs
Itim I give unto my second sonne Thomas Touns 12 pence
The rest of all my goods and Chattells, unbequeaved I give & bequeave unto my loveinge wife Alice Touns & to my daughter Marye Touns whome I make & ordayne Joyntly both of them together executrices of this my last will & testament, to see my debts & legacies payed, & my bodie brought reverently brought to the ground
Lastly I make & ordaine John Foster & William Nicholson of Claxton aforesaid, overseers of this my last will & testament
Thomas Touns his marke
Testes sunt
Thomas Wright Scriptor
Margerye Sprickly her marke
Probate 4 September 1637

A true inventory of all the goods & Chattells of Thomas Touns of Claxton als Long Clauston in the Countie of Leceister Laborer, taken this 19th of August 1637 By John Foster husbandman & William Nicholson Laborer of Claxton aforesaid
£ | s | d | |
In primis his purse & apparel | 0 | 6 | 8 |
Itim in the parler 3 Coverleads, 1 pillowe, 2 blanketts | 0 | 16 | 0 |
Itim sheets, 1 payre of flaxen, 1 of hempton, 1 pillowe bere, 1 towell | 0 | 16 | 0 |
Itim 2 bedsteads, 2 Cofers & other Impleaments of wood | 0 | 12 | 0 |
Itim pueter & brasse and other Impleaments | 0 | 10 | 0 |
Itim the omprye, a table & frame, 1 forme | 0 | 5 | 0 |
Itim 2 Cheares, 1 stoole | 0 | 1 | 0 |
Itim 1 Chorne, 1 tub, 2 kymnells, and dishes & trenchers, 1 barell, and other | |||
implements of wood | 0 | 4 | 0 |
Itim 2 Cowes | 4 | 0 | 0 |
Itim 1 sorye barley land & peas land, a litle ould hea, 1 pigge | 1 | 10 | 0 |
Itim 4 hens, 4 Chickens, 1 Cocke, some Coales | 0 | 6 | 8 |
Itim 1 skeppe, & woole | 0 | 8 | 0 |
Itim the fire Iron, & other impleaments of Iron, 1 spade, 1 forke, with other | |||
impleaments & things forgotten | 0 | 0 | 12 |
The whole sume is | 9 | 14 | 4 |
Debts to be payed | |||
To Henrye Stokes | 2 | 0 | 0 |
To Michaell Dubleday | 2 | 0 | 0 |
To John Foster | 0 | 16 | 0 |
To William Nicholson | 0 | 8 | 0 |
The whole sume is | 5 | 4 | 0 |
The remander is | 4 | 14 | 0 |
